Basic Stage Fight
Forsyth Hall, St. Albert Public Library
Sat, Sept 10th 1-1:50pm 

Completed

Stage-fight is different from what is used in film. In this fun session you will learn 3 basic moves (slap, strangle, trip) and how, with practice, to make them look realistic. These moves can be used in serious dramatic and comedy scenes. (Wear comfortable clothing and absolutely no jewelry.)

Maureen Rooney is a professional actor with over 40 years of experience in theatre.  Recipient of the 2013 Mayor’s Lifetime Achievement in the Arts Award with partner Paul Punyi they have worked with some of Canada’s finest theatres and in film/TV.  Rooney and Punyi Productions is an educational theatre company touring Canada with a repertoire of 25 shows, as well as performing arts residencies in schools, and creating/presenting commissioned works for special events such as “Meet the Street” for St Albert’s 150th and “Rutherford Tory” and  “Sam & Maye” for UofA, and the grand opening of the Royal Albert Museum for Queen Elizabeth II.   www.rooneyandpunyi.ca
